[employed to replace Chinese, in pe Ee ———————————————_—_—_—_=__ “Trp exterisive McCormick Reapér Works at Chicago’ closed down Tuesday morning, and 1,400 employes were forced ‘out. The threat of certain men to precipitate a Bttike tinless the non-uhién men working in the moulding department were ‘dismissed _ ‘appears to have, been the cause of the suspension of operations.
